Transaction e50831b2cbfc2883ff5a762c3a0b2306dabfb15ab000d87560c51c4f36b3fa69
1 Input
1 Output
-
e50831b2cbfc2883ff5a762c3a0b2306dabfb15ab000d87560c51c4f36b3fa69:0
- value
- 16665990
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7cb8b553ef242dcb9b3c2bd43430b9fd633c91d2 OP_EQUAL
- address
- 3D4Uz68S9yS2CW57k1uJA5Q9drxvJ2q5of